DANG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2014 in Review

76 of the 3,463 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in E-COMMERCE CHINA DANGDANG INC SPNSRD ADS REP COM CL A (CYM) (DANG) for Q1 2014, worth a combined $176M — up 32% from $134M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 31 funds opened new DANG positions and 13 closed out — a net gain of 18 holders — while 20 added to existing stakes and 19 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Renaissance Technologies, opening a new position worth an estimated $16.5M. The largest seller was Alpha Wave Global, exiting entirely with an estimated $41.9M sold.
